The technical data of the Epson EB W17 includes 2800 ANSI lumens, a contrast of 10000:1 as well as a WXGA 1280 x 800 display. The runtime of the lamp in this model is estimated at 5000 hours before a replacement is necessary, achieving a lifespan of 6.8 years when used for 2 hours a day. To compensate for angled projection positions, the model features 2D keystone correction, which digitally corrects trapezoidal distortion. Looking at practical performance, up to 538 cm can be illuminated with 2800 ANSI lumens in dark environments. Once daylight is in the room, the image should ideally be no wider than 359 cm. Since entering the market in 2013, production has been discontinued; the manufacturer no longer actively offers the model.
